Transaction 1b34e89b7d4252a320de4ab9eede46da6003e29a7f7aaa2380599c8dae642a51
3 Input
2 Outputs
- 1b34e89b7d4252a320de4ab9eede46da6003e29a7f7aaa2380599c8dae642a51:0
- 1b34e89b7d4252a320de4ab9eede46da6003e29a7f7aaa2380599c8dae642a51:1
value 10229630
address 17Ka2X6Zizu8Tc4SMVGMJHxB6veC9xpCsu
value 385196469
address 3BHWJE1dDPsnVrwmR4DhNJJXWANwhKQqh6